Hancock is a super hero of the special kind: The rude addicted to alcohol hero always creates a chaos surrounding his "heroic deeds" the city has to clean up. Slowly but surely the public has enough of their hero. When Hancock saves PR consultant Ray's life he wants to help him with an image campaign in return as a thank you. But Ray's wife Mary has a problem with that.
